Take The A Train with Close Voicings
Practice your close voicings with this famous jazz standard "Take The A Train"! Close voicings are often called "rootless voicings", or - when played in the left hand - "left hand voicings". For maj7 and min7 chords we use 9th chords (maj9 and min9) without the root. For dom7 chords we use guide tones + 9 and 13, again without the root. You can also use these left hand voicings to comp, so a backing track can be helpful to practice along!
